Digging a Goal: A Strategic Digging and Puzzle Adventure
Digging a Goal is a strategic puzzle game where players swipe to carve tunnels underground, guiding a rolling ball to its target. The core appeal of Digging a Goal lies in its blend of intuitive controls and physics-based challenges. Players must think critically to design pathways that avoid hazards like spikes, making every level a unique test of foresight and precision. This engaging loop of planning, executing, and adapting is what makes Digging a Goal a compelling download for fans of casual brain-teasers.

Intuitive Swipe-Based Tunnel Creation
In Digging a Goal, players interact with the environment through a direct swipe-to-dig mechanic. To play, you swipe your finger across the screen to remove earth and create a path for the ball to roll through. The primary action is strategic excavation; you must decide the angle, length, and direction of each tunnel segment to ensure a clear route to the goal. This simple control scheme forms the foundation of every puzzle in Digging a Goal, requiring players to visualize the ball's entire journey before making their first dig.
